description | A new method of retrieving quantitative information on the hard, soft, and diffraction collision’s frequencies from inhomogeneously pressure-broadened line profiles was proposed and tested. The essence of the method lies in the processing of recorded profiles using various profiles’ models containing these frequencies treated as adjustable parameters in different manners. Three self-broadened H2O absorption lines free of an instrumental function were processed with the use of four model line profiles. Retrieved set of pressure line broadening and narrowing constants allows finding out the sought frequencies. The estimation of the total scattering cross section, ∼630 Å2, in pure water vapor was made. |
